Chinese energy company president meets CM

LAHORE, Nov 8 (APP): President of a prominent Chinese
company in energy sector Zoenergy, Yu Yong, met Punjab Chief
Minister Muhammad Shehbaz Sharif here on Sunday.
Matters regarding progress on solar projects being set up
at Quaid-e-Azam Solar Park Bahawalpur under the China Pakistan
Economic Corridor (CPEC) were discussed in the meeting.
Speaking on the occasion, Shehbaz Sharif said the CPEC
project was being speedily implemented in Punjab and
completion of power projects within stipulated period was a
mission of the government.
He said besides solar energy, work on power projects
based on gas and coal were also continuing adding that
completion of energy projects would result in availability of
low-cost electricity to the masses.
The CPEC projects would be completed on priority basis, he
added.
